When to Use Each Day

🏋️ High Carb Days

Heavy lifting, HIIT, intense training

🚶 Medium Carb Days

Moderate cardio, light training

😴 Low Carb Days

Rest days, light activity only

Understanding Carb Cycling

Benefits of Carb Cycling

Carb cycling can enhance fat burning on low days while still providing energy for performance on high days. It may also help maintain thyroid function and leptin levels compared to constant low-carb diets.

Tips for Success

Plan high-carb days around your hardest workouts. Focus on complex carbs like oats, rice, and potatoes. On low days, get carbs from vegetables and limit starchy sources.
